"serve:pro": "NODE_ENV='production' vue-cli-service serve", "build": "NODE_ENV='test' vue-cli-service build", "build:pro": "NODE_ENV='production' vue-cli-service build", "lint": "vue-cli-service lint" 然后配置api的地方 if( process.env.NODE_ENV === 'test' ){ apiUrl = '测...
阅读webpack4官网文档Mode,里面提到Ifnotset,webpacksetsproductionasthedefaultvalueformode.Thesupportedvaluesformodeare:如果没有设置mode值,默认mode值为"production"。设置process.env.NODE_ENV还能通过mode值读取。测试下来貌似最终读取的是mode的值 0 0 0 没找到需要的内容?换个关键词再搜索试试 向你推荐 js在...
2.也可以在webpack文件下的配置文件config里面设置 module.exports= {build: {env: {NODE_ENV:'"production"'} },dev: {env: {NODE_ENV:'"development"'} } } 那么在build文件夹下的比如webpack.dev.conf.js文件里(node环境?)读取process.env.NODE_ENV是读取的那个文件定义的NODE_ENV值呢? 以及在src下...
(3)NODE_ENV=“someone”,环境变量随便给一个值,它会默认为NODE_ENV=“development” 的打包策略。包内的内容如下: 所以运行 vue-cli-service build 命令时,无论部署到哪个环境,都应该始终把 NODE_ENV 设置为 “production“ ,区别环境时可以以 VUE_APP_ 开头的变量命名赋值。 详见官方文档:https://cli.vue...
我的问题是,通常大家设置 NODE_ENV 这个变量在哪设置? 1.package.json 文件里可以设置为 "dev": "cross-env NODE_ENV=development webpack-dev-server --inline --progress --config build/webpack.dev.conf.js", "build": "cross-env NODE_ENV=production webpack --config build/webpack.prod.conf.js...
好办,给NODE_ENV增加新的值不就行了。 增加新的值的最简单办法是在package.json里面加,这样,既一目了然,又不入侵src目录的文件。 操作 package.json里往往会有这么一句: "dev": "npm run dev", "build": "npm run build", 现在我给它增加几个弟兄: ...
Nagos是一款开源电脑系统和网络监视工具,能够有效监控windows,linux,Uninx的主机状态,交换机路由器等网络...
1.linux环境下:PORT=1234 node app.js 使用上面命令每次都需要重新设置,如果想设置一次永久生效,使用下面的命令。export PORT=1234 node app.js 2.windows下面按照顺序这样进行:set PORT=1234 node app.js
NodeJS中,process.env.PORT是一个环境变量,用于指定服务器监听的端口号。该环境变量的值是由操作系统或部署环境决定的。 具体分配方式如下: 1. 开发环境下,可以手动设置proc...
这种方式设置process.env.NODE_ENV的值,但是windows不支持;的设置方式,所以可以把;换成&&,即: NODE_ENV=development && webpack --mode=production --config webpack.config.js 不过!这样设置windows还是会有问题,说到底原因是windows不支持NODE_ENV=development这样赋值。